Lisa Harper LIFE: 100-Day Devotional for Grateful Joy, Jesus-Undone Faith & Real Hope in Hard Times

Lisa Harper's LIFE is a 100-day devotional applying Scripture to everyday struggles like loss, trauma, and chaos. Its gut-level honesty and 4.7-star acclaim make it ideal for women craving authentic Gospel hope.

  • Rediscover God's grace for massive crises and minor mishaps alike
  • Build obsessively grateful, genuinely happy faith through 100 daily insights
  • Navigate personal loss, trauma, or bad days with Scripture's redemptive power
  • Experience being undone by Jesus without faking joy in tough stuff
  • Gain tangible hope proving the Gospel transforms real, crazy life

Relatable gut-level exploration of Scripture for everyday realities. Proven high reader satisfaction from strong ratings. Concise 100-day format fits busy schedules.

Primarily geared toward women's perspectives. Lacks supplementary features like audio or study guides. Casual tone may not suit highly structured Bible studies.
